JKAP terminates membership of Javid Beigh for ‘Anti Party Activities’
Srinagar: The Jammu & Kashmir Apni Party (JKAP) on Monday removed its party leader Javid Hassan Beigh from the basic membership, for “Anti Party Activities” in North Kashmir’s Baramulla district.
“As informed by District Committee Baramulla, Mr. Javid Hassan Beigh has been found involved in Anti Party Activities,” a statement issued by JKAP General Secretary, Rafi Ahmad Mir reads.
“Since it goes against the basic constitution of the party, his basic membership is hereby terminated, and he is expelled from the party for a period of 5 years,” reads the statement.
